Don’t blame it on the Devil

Nov 21st, 2009 | By Sean | Category: God and Philosophy

We go through this life being taught in Church that ‘it’s the Devil who did this’, ‘it’s the Devil who did that’. We are made to think that the Devil is the antagonist and that he is responsible for our miseries and our pitfalls. I tell you the truth, the Devil will be judged by God for his own sins, not for the sins he tempted you to commit – those sins are on your own hands.
